There is provided a fluorescence spectroscopic apparatus includes an
exciting optical unit configured to irradiate the same sample area with a
plurality of excitation lights of different wavelength bands, an optical
unit configured to repeatedly guide fluorescences emitted by the sample
in response to the respective excitation lights, to a detection unit, and
a calculation unit configured to perform analysis on the basis of a
comparison of output signals corresponding to the fluorescences from the
detection unit, wherein the exciting optical unit includes an excitation
light varying unit configured to intermittently vary the intensity of at
least one excitation light.
